What is Ceramic Coating?
Ceramic coating is a liquid polymer applied to the exterior of a vehicle. Once cured, it forms a chemical bond with the factory paint, creating a protective layer. Unlike traditional waxes or sealants, ceramic coatings are highly durable and can last for years, providing a long-lasting gloss and protection. The main component of ceramic coatings is silicon dioxide (SiO2), which is derived from natural materials like quartz and sand. This compound gives ceramic coatings their unique properties, including hydrophobicity, UV resistance, and chemical resistance.
The Science Behind Ceramic Coating
The effectiveness of ceramic coating lies in its molecular structure. When applied, the coating forms a nano-ceramic layer that fills in the microscopic pores of the vehicle's paint. This creates a smooth, even surface that repels water, dirt, and other contaminants. The hydrophobic nature of ceramic coatings means that water beads up and rolls off the surface, taking with it any dirt or grime. This self-cleaning effect reduces the need for frequent washing and helps maintain the car's pristine appearance.
Key Benefits of Ceramic Coating
- Enhanced Durability: Ceramic coatings provide a hard, protective layer that is resistant to scratches, swirl marks, and minor abrasions. This durability helps preserve the vehicle's paint and keeps it looking new for longer.
- UV Protection: The coating acts as a barrier against harmful UV rays, preventing oxidation and fading of the paint. This is particularly beneficial for vehicles exposed to direct sunlight for extended periods.
- Hydrophobic Properties: The water-repelling nature of ceramic coatings ensures that water and other liquids slide off the surface effortlessly, reducing the risk of water spots and stains.
- Easy Maintenance: With a ceramic coating, maintaining your vehicle becomes easier. The smooth surface prevents dirt and grime from sticking, making cleaning a breeze.
- Glossy Finish: One of the most appealing aspects of ceramic coatings is the deep, glossy finish they provide, enhancing the overall look of the vehicle.

The Application Process of Ceramic Coating
Applying ceramic coating is a meticulous process that requires precision and attention to detail. The process begins with thorough cleaning and decontamination of the vehicle's surface to remove any dirt, grease, or previous waxes. This step is crucial as it ensures that the coating adheres properly to the paint.
Once the surface is clean, a clay bar treatment is often used to eliminate any remaining contaminants. After this, the paint may undergo a polishing process to remove any imperfections, such as swirl marks or scratches. This ensures a smooth surface for the coating application.
The ceramic coating is then carefully applied in small sections using an applicator pad. It is important to follow the manufacturer's instructions regarding the duration for which the coating should be left to cure before being buffed off. This curing process is essential for the formation of a strong chemical bond with the paint.
Common Misconceptions About Ceramic Coating
Despite its growing popularity, there are several misconceptions about ceramic coating that can lead to unrealistic expectations. One common myth is that ceramic coating makes a car completely scratch-proof. While it does provide a significant level of scratch resistance, it is not impervious to all types of damage, particularly from sharp objects or harsh impacts.
Another misconception is that ceramic coating eliminates the need for regular maintenance. Although the coating reduces the frequency of washing and waxing, routine maintenance is still necessary to preserve its protective qualities and aesthetic appeal. Regular washing with a pH-neutral shampoo and avoiding abrasive cleaning methods are recommended.
Lastly, some believe that ceramic coating can repair existing paint damage. It's important to note that ceramic coating is not a paint correction solution. It is designed to protect the existing paint, not to fix or hide imperfections.
Choosing the Right Ceramic Coating for Your Vehicle
With a variety of ceramic coating products available on the market, selecting the right one for your vehicle can be challenging. Factors to consider include the reputation of the brand, the level of protection offered, and the longevity of the coating. It's also essential to consider whether a professional application or a DIY approach is more suitable for your needs and expertise.
Professional-grade ceramic coatings often offer superior protection and durability but require professional installation. On the other hand, DIY kits are more accessible and cost-effective but may not provide the same level of protection as professional products. Assessing your budget, expectations, and willingness to invest time in the application process will guide you in making the best choice.
When deciding on the right ceramic coating for your vehicle, it's also crucial to consider the specific needs of your car and the environmental conditions it faces. Vehicles that are frequently exposed to harsh weather, road salts, or industrial fallout may require a more robust coating with higher chemical resistance. For those living in areas with intense sunlight, UV protection might be a priority. Understanding these factors can help tailor your choice to ensure optimal protection and performance.
